Is Ratched a hit?

Ratched has evidently proved a hit for Netflix, and arguably the biggest success to come out of its US$300 million production deal with American Horror Story and Glee creator Ryan Murphy.

Is the show Ratched good to look at?

  • Ratched is, however, visually arresting. The use of color, in particular, is as breathtaking and inventive as any design you'll find in television or film, and it's almost worth watching this absurd series just to enjoy it. It is the deep blues of this institution that play off the pale colors we know from most hospital shows.
